Causes of death in Korean patients with systemic lupus erythematosus: a single center retrospective study. Clin Exp Rheumatol 1999; 17:539-45. [PMID: 10544836]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/14/2023]
Abstract
OBJECTIVE To determine the causes of death in Korean patients with systemic lupus erythematosus (SLE). METHODS We evaluated retrospectively Korean SLE patients who were monitored in the Center for Rheumatic Disease in Kang-Nam St. Mary's Hospital from 1993 to 1997 and who died. RESULTS Forty-three (7.9%) of 544 patients died. Comparison of demographics and disease activity indices between the deceased and the survivors showed that the age was older and C3 at presentation was lower in the deceased (n = 40) than the survivors (n = 453) (age: 33.8 +/- 13.6 versus 28.3 +/- 10.6 years, p = 0.02, C3: 36.8 +/- 21.4 versus 49.7 +/- 20.8 mg/dl, p = 0.03). Among 40 patients who died, the frequency and causes of death were as follows: 13 from infection (32.5%), 10 SLE-related factors (25.0%), 6 pulmonary hypertension (15.0%), 4 cerebrovascular accidents (10.0%), and 3 thrombotic thrombocytopenic purpura (7.5%). The majority of the SLE-related deaths were non-renal in origin, including 3 cerebral nervous system disease, 2 TTP, 2 acute pulmonary hemorrhage syndrome, 1 acute myocarditis, and 1 multi-system illness. SLE-related renal causes were responsible for only death. The major organisms of infection were gram negative bacilli (69.2%), primarily manifesting as sepsis or bacteremia (76.9%). The patients (n = 13) who died from infection had lower levels of complement and higher levels of anti-ds DNA antibody at presentation than those (n = 27) who died from the other causes (C3: 24.7 +/- 17.8 versus 41.7 +/- 21.5 mg/dl, p = 0.02, anti-dsDNA antibody: 68.0 +/- 73.5 versus 27.0 +/- 35.3 IU, p = 0.04). The mean steroid dose being administered one month before death was also higher in the patients who died of infection (30.5 +/- 15.2 versus 15.2 +/- 7.7 mg/day, p = 0.03). Patients who died of pulmonary hypertension, the third most common cause of mortality, showed extremely high pulmonary pressures at the initial diagnosis, with a short interval to death, and had less major organ involvement at death. There were no deaths due to coronary heart disease or neoplasm in this cohort. CONCLUSION The most common cause of death in 544 Korean lupus patients was infection, mainly manifesting as gram negative bacterial sepsis. SLE-related factors (mostly non-renal) were the next most frequent cause. Death from infection was associated with higher disease activity at presentation and a higher dose of steroid used previously. Death due to pulmonary hypertension was common, whereas death due to coronary heart disease was absent.

Abstract
In this report, we have prepared self-assembling nanospheres of hydrophobized pullulans. Pullulan acetate as a hydrophobized pullulan was synthesized by acetylation of pullulan and characterized by Fourier transform infrared (FTIR) measurement. From the results of photon correlation spectroscopy (PCS), hydrophobized pullulans could be self-assembled in water as nanospherical aggregates, and their number-average particle size was 74.3 +/- 38.2 nm with a unimodal distribution. Also, morphological studies observed by transmission electron microscopy (TEM) showed that self-assembly of hydrophobized pullulans results in nice spherical shapes with a size range of about 50-100 nm, which was in accordance with PCS measurements. Their size and morphology have acceptable properties for intravenous injectable drug-targeting carriers. The fluorescence probe technique was used for self-association of hydrophobized pullulans in water using pyrene as a hydrophobic probe. From the fluorescence measurement, the fluorescence intensity of pyrene increased with increasing concentration of hydrophobized pullulans, which indicates self-assembly formation of hydrophobized pullulans in water. Also, in the fluorescence excitation spectrum, a red shift was observed with increasing concentration of hydrophobized pullulans. These results also revealed that hydrophobized pullulans could be self-assembled in water, and from the plot of I337/I334 versus log c of hydrophobized pullulans, the critical association concentration was 0.0022 g/l, which was considerably lower than that of low molecular weight surfactants or poloxamer. A drug loading study was performed using clonazepam (CNZ) as a hydrophobic model drug. We observed that the higher the feeding amount of drug was, the more the drug loading contents were, the lower the drug loading efficiency was, and the larger the particle size was. CNZ was released from nanospheres via pseudo-zero-order kinetics, and the increased drug loading contents led to slower release of the drug.

Abstract
We report a case of insufficiency fracture of the sternum in a 70-year-old female patient with a review of the literature. She complained of sudden onset chest pain and aggravating dyspnea. She has been managed with corticosteroid due to chronic obstructive pulmonary disease for 15 years. Diagnosis of sternal insufficiency fracture presented with thoracic kyphosis was made on the basis of absence of trauma history, radiologic findings of lateral chest radiograph, bone scintigraphy and chest computed tomography. Thoracic kyphosis and osteoporosis secondary to menopause, corticosteroid therapy and limited mobility due to chronic obstructive pulmonary disease were considered as predisposing factors of the sternal insufficiency fracture in this patient.

Polyelectroylte complex composed of chitosan and sodium alginate for wound dressing application. JOURNAL OF BIOMATERIALS SCIENCE. POLYMER EDITION 1999; 10:543-56. [PMID: 10357265 DOI: 10.1163/156856299x00478] [Citation(s) in RCA: 99]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 11/19/2022]
Abstract
Drug-impregnated polyelectrolyte complex (PEC) sponge composed of chitosan and sodium alginate was prepared for wound dressing application. The morphological structure of this wound dressing was observed to be composed of a dense skin outer layer and a porous cross-section layer by scanning electron microscopy (SEM). Equilibrium water content and release of silver sulfadiazine (AgSD) could be controlled by the number of repeated in situ PEC reactions between chitosan and sodium alginate. The release of AgSD from AgSD-impregnated PEC wound dressing in PBS buffer (PH = 7.4) was dependent on the number of repeated in situ complex formations for the wound dressing. The antibacterial capacity of AgSD-impregnated wound dressing was examined in agar plate against Pseudomonas aeruginosa and Staphylococcus aureus. From the behavior of antimicrobial release and the suppression of bacterial proliferation, it is thought that the PEC wound dressing containing antimicrobial agents could protect the wound surfaces from bacterial invasion and effectively suppress bacterial proliferation. In the cytotoxicity test, cellular damage was reduced by the controlled released of AgSD from the sponge matrix of AgSD-medicated wound dressing. In vivo tests showed that granulation tissue formation and wound contraction for the AgSD plus dihydroepiandrosterone (DHEA) impregnated PEC wound dressing were faster than any other groups.

Structure and mechanism of glutamate racemase from Aquifex pyrophilus. NATURE STRUCTURAL BIOLOGY 1999; 6:422-6. [PMID: 10331867 DOI: 10.1038/8223] [Citation(s) in RCA: 79] [Impact Index Per Article: 3.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 11/08/2022]
Abstract
Glutamate racemase (MurI) is responsible for the synthesis of D-glutamate, an essential building block of the peptidoglycan layer in bacterial cell walls. The crystal structure of glutamate racemase from Aquifex pyrophilus, determined at 2.3 A resolution, reveals that the enzyme forms a dimer and each monomer consists of two alpha/beta fold domains, a unique structure that has not been observed in other racemases or members of an enolase superfamily. A substrate analog, D-glutamine, binds to the deep pocket formed by conserved residues from two monomers. The structural and mutational analyses allow us to propose a mechanism of metal cofactor-independent glutamate racemase in which two cysteine residues are involved in catalysis.

Clonazepam release from bioerodible hydrogels based on semi-interpenetrating polymer networks composed of poly(epsilon-caprolactone) and poly(ethylene glycol) macromer. Int J Pharm 1999; 181:235-42. [PMID: 10370219 DOI: 10.1016/s0378-5173(99)00031-9] [Citation(s) in RCA: 29] [Impact Index Per Article: 1.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/30/2022]
Abstract
Poly(ethylene glycol)(PEG) macromers terminated with acrylate groups and semi-interpenetrating polymer networks (SIPNs) composed of poly(epsilon-caprolactone)(PCL) and PEG macromer were synthesized to obtain a bioerodible hydrogel. Polymerization of PEG macromer resulted in the formation of cross-linked gels due to the multifunctionality of macromer. Glass transition temperature (Tg) and melting temperature (Tm) of PEG networks and PCL in the SIPNs were inner-shifted, indicating an interpenetration of PCL and PEG chains. Water content in the SIPNs increased with increasing PEG weight fraction due to the hydrophilicity of PEG. The amount of clonazepam (CNZ) released from the SIPNs increased with higher content in the SIPNs, lower drug loading, lower concentration of PEG macromer during the SIPNs preparation, and higher molecular weight of PEG. In particular, a combination with low PEG content and low CNZ solubility in water led to long-term constant release from these matrices in vitro and in vivo.

Abstract
Prolonged circulation of anticancer agent in blood is expected to decrease the host toxicity and enhance the anticancer activity. The purpose of this study is to develop and characterize the prolonged and sustained release formulation of anticancer agent using biodegradable poly(gamma-benzyl-L-glutamate)/poly(ethylene oxide) (PBLG/PEO) polymer nanoparticles. PBLG/PEO polymer is a hydrophilic/hydrophobic block copolymer and forms a micelle-like structure in solution. Spherical nanoparticles incorporating adriamycin were prepared by a dialysis method. The fluorescence intensity of adriamycin in the nanoparticles was increased when sodium dodecylsulfate was added. It is one of the evidences of entrapment of adriamycin in the polymer nanoparticles. Only 20% of entrapped drug was released in 24 h at 37 degrees C a and the release was dependent on the molecular weight of hydrophobic polymer. The endothermic peak of adriamycin at 197 degrees C disappeared in the nanoparticles system, suggesting the inhibition of a crystallization of adriamycin by polymer adsorption during the precipitation process. The mean residence time of adriamycin from the nanoparticles was more than threefold that from a free adriamycin. These results suggest usefulness of PBLG/PEO nanoparticles as a sustained and prolonged release carrier for adriamycin.

Crystallization and preliminary x-ray analysis of glutamate racemase from Aquifex pyrophilus, a hyperthermophilic bacterium. ACTA CRYSTALLOGRAPHICA SECTION D: BIOLOGICAL CRYSTALLOGRAPHY 1999; 55:927-8. [PMID: 10089337 DOI: 10.1107/s0907444999000608]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 11/10/2022]
Abstract
Glutamate racemase catalyzes the reversible reaction of L-glutamate to D-glutamate, an essential component of the bacterial cell wall. Glutamate racemase from Aquifex pyrophilus has been crystallized by the hanging-drop vapor-diffusion method using polyethylene glycol 6000 as a precipitant. The crystals belong to space group P6122 or P6522 with unit-cell parameters a = b = 72.1, c = 185.02 A. The asymmetric unit contains one molecule, corresponding to a Vm value of 2.35 A3 Da-1. Complete data sets from a native and a mercury-derivative crystal have been collected at 2.0 and 2.3 A resolution, respectively, using a synchrotron-radiation source.

Abstract
A 54-year-old male farmer residing in Chunchon, Korea, complaining of blood tinged discharge and tinnitus in the left ear for two days, was examined in August 16, 1996. Otoscopic examination revealed live maggots from the ear canal. The patient did not complain of any symptoms after removal of maggots. Five maggots recovered were identified as the third stage larvae of Lucilia sericata (Diptera: Calliphoridae). This is the first record of aural myiasis in Korea.

Expression, purification, characterization and crystallization of flap endonuclease-1 from Methanococcus jannaschii. Mol Cells 1999; 9:45-8. [PMID: 10102570]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/11/2023] Open
Abstract
A gene coding for a protein homologous to the flap endonuclease-1 (FEN-1) was cloned from Methanococcus jannaschii, overexpressed, purified and characterized. The gene product from M. jannaschii shows 5' endo-/exonuclease and 5' pseudo-Y-endonuclease activities as observed in the FEN-1 in eukaryotes. In addition, Methanococcus jannaschii FEN-1 functions effectively at high concentrations of salt, unlike eukaryotic FEN-1. We have crystallized Methanococcus jannaschii FEN-1 and analyzed its preliminary character. The crystal belongs to the space group of P2(1) with unit cell dimensions of a = 58.93 A, b = 42.53 A, c = 62.62 A and beta = 92.250. A complete data set has been collected at 2.0 A resolution using a frozen crystal.

An infestation of the mite Sancassania berlesei (Acari: Acaridae) in the external auditory canal of a Korean man. J Parasitol 1999; 85:133-4. [PMID: 10207379]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/11/2023] Open
Abstract
We here report the case of a storage mite, Sancassania berlesei, infestation in the external auditory canal of a 46-yr-old male. He complained of feeling a foreign body and itching in the left external auditory canal for 1 mo, with accompanying otalgia for 3 days. Considering the duration of the patient's complaint and the 8-9-day life cycle of the mite, the mites are believed to have lived in the patient's ear for more than 3 generations.

Abstract
A 13-year-old girl presented with multiple skin abscesses. She was diagnosed as having juvenile dermatomyositis (DM) at the age of 7 years. She had suffered from recurrent skin infections, atypical pruritic dermatitis and pneumonia since the age of 8 years. Bacteriologic and fungal cultures for skin abscesses and oral mucosa were positive S. aureus and C. albicans, respectively. Chemotactic defect in peripheral blood neutrophils was observed. The level of serum IgE was markedly elevated, and anti-S.aureus specific IgE was found. A diagnosis of hyperimmunoglobulin E-recurrent infection syndrome (HIE) was made and she was successfully treated with surgical drainage and antibiotics. To our knowledge, this is the first case report of HIE in a patient with juvenile dermatomyositis.

Clonazepam release from poly(DL-lactide-co-glycolide) nanoparticles prepared by dialysis method. Arch Pharm Res 1998; 21:418-22. [PMID: 9875469 DOI: 10.1007/bf02974636] [Citation(s) in RCA: 27]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/29/2022]
Abstract
Aim of this work is to prepare poly(DL-lactide-co-glycolide) (PLGA) nanoparticles by dialysis method without surfactant and to investigate drug loading capacity and drug release. The size of PLGA nanoparticles was 269.9 +/- 118.7 nm in intensity average and the morphology of PLGA nanoparticles was spherical shape from the observation of SEM and TEM. In the effect of drug loading contents on the particle size distribution, PLGA nanoparticles were monomodal pattern with narrow size distribution in the empty and lower drug loading nanoparticles whereas bi- or trimodal pattern was showed in the higher drug loading ones. Release of clonazepam from PLGA nanoparticles with higher drug loading contents was slower than that with lower loading contents.

Abstract
Behçet's disease is a chronic multisystemic disorder involving many organs and characterized by recurrent oral and genital ulcers and relapsing iritis. A case of BD with large vein thrombosis involving superior and inferior vena cava is presented. Large vein thrombosis in BD is not commonly developed and most commonly observed in the inferior or superior vena cava. A review of the literature emphasizes the rarity of the combined superior and inferior vena caval occlusion. Existence of extensive large vein occlusion in BD is associated with limited therapy and poor prognosis.

Abstract
Block copolymers consisting of poly(gamma-benzyl L-glutamate) (PBLG) as the hydrophobic block and poly(ethylene oxide) (PEO) as the hydrophilic block were synthesized and characterized. Core-shell type nanoparticles of the block copolymers (abbreviated as GE) were prepared by the diafiltration method. The particle size diameter obtained by dynamic light scattering of GE-1 (PBLG content: 60.5 mol%), GE-2 (PBLG content: 40.0 mol %), GE-3 (PBLG content: 124.4 mol %) copolymer was 309.9 +/- 160.9, 251.9 +/- 220.6 and 200.5 +/- 177.1nm, respectively. The shape of the nanoparticles by SEM or TEM was almost spherical. The critical micelle concentration of the block copolymers obtained by fluorescence spectroscopy was dependent on the chain length of hydrophobic PBLG. The micelle structure of the copolymers nanoparticle was very stable against sodium dodecyl sulfate. Clonazepam (CZ) was loaded onto the core part of the nanoparticle as the crystalline state. Release of CZ from the nanoparticles in vitro was dependent on the drug loading contents and PBLG chain length.

Immunological and molecular analysis of three monoclonal lupus anticoagulant antibodies from a patient with systemic lupus erythematosus. J Autoimmun 1998; 11:39-51. [PMID: 9480722 DOI: 10.1006/jaut.1997.0174] [Citation(s) in RCA: 13]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/06/2023]
Abstract
Antiphospholipid antibodies (APA), including lupus anticoagulants (LAC; as detected by in vitro blood clotting tests) and anti-cardiolipin antibodies (ACA; as assayed by solid-phase immunoassay), are strongly associated with recurrent thrombosis, thrombocytopenia, and recurrent fetal loss in some patients with systemic lupus erythematosus (SLE). The combined presence of APA and these clinical manifestations is termed antiphospholipid syndrome (APS). LAC and ACA comprise heterogeneous and somewhat overlapping autoantibody subsets. To date, it is unclear what degree of heterogeneity is present in an individual patient and between patients. To begin to address these issues, we generated three monoclonal LAC antibodies from a patient with SLE and APS. These antibodies were studied for their binding specificities and variable (V) region nucleotide sequences. All three LAC were unreactive with DNA, cardiolipin or other phospholipids. Sequence analysis of these antibodies revealed extensive overlap in their Ig V genes with anti-DNA antibodies and other autoantibodies characteristic of lupus. These data provide the first V gene sequence information on a group of SLE-derived LAC without ACA activity, representative of a similar subset of LAC found in patients with APS.

Methoxy poly(ethylene glycol)/epsilon-caprolactone amphiphilic block copolymeric micelle containing indomethacin. I. Preparation and characterization. J Control Release 1998; 51:1-11. [PMID: 9685899 DOI: 10.1016/s0168-3659(97)00164-8] [Citation(s) in RCA: 202] [Impact Index Per Article: 7.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/08/2023]
Abstract
Amphiphilic diblock copolymers composed of methoxy polyethylene glycol (MePEG) and epsilon-caprolactone (epsilon-CL) were prepared for the formation of micelles. The copolymer was formed by ring opening mechanism of epsilon-CL in the presence of MePEG containing hydroxyl functional groups at one end of the chain. To estimate their feasibility as vehicles for drugs, MePEG/epsilon-CL block copolymeric micelles were prepared by dialysis against water. Indomethacin was incorporated into the hydrophobic inner core of these micelles as a typical model drug for non-steroidal anti-inflammatory drugs. From the dynamic light scattering measurements, the size of micelle formed was less than 200 mm, and their size increases with the amount of indomethacin encapsulated into the inner core of MePEG/epsilon-CL block copolymers. The selected solvents used to prepare micelles by dialysis in water affect the size of polymeric micelles. As the hydrophobic components of copolymer increase, the critical micelle concentration values and hydrophilic-lipophilic balance decreased. An increase of molecular weight and hydrophobic components of diblock copolymer produced larger micelles.

Methoxy poly(ethylene glycol) and epsilon-caprolactone amphiphilic block copolymeric micelle containing indomethacin. II. Micelle formation and drug release behaviours. J Control Release 1998; 51:13-22. [PMID: 9685900 DOI: 10.1016/s0168-3659(97)00124-7] [Citation(s) in RCA: 257] [Impact Index Per Article: 9.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/29/2022]
Abstract
Amphiphilic diblock copolymer composed of methoxy poly(ethylene glycol) and epsilon-caprolactone (epsilon-CL) was prepared by polymerization of epsilon-CL initiated with MePEG. MePEG/epsilon-CL block copolymeric micelles containing indomethacin (IMC) were prepared by a dialysis method and evaluated as a novel drug carrier. The size of micelle formed was less than 200 nm, and the size distribution of the micelle showed a narrow and monodisperse unimodal pattern. Also, the micelles formed by a dialysis method exhibited spherical structures. The indomethacin content in nanospheres was about 42.2%, for those prepared using copolymer, having molecular weight of about 12,000 and polymer/IMC weight ratio of 1/1. A release rate of indomethacin from nanospheres was slow, and thus the release continued over 15 days. As the molecular weights of the copolymer and the amount of drug entrapped increased, the release rate decreased. These results indicated that the drug-loaded nanospheres could be useful as a novel drug carrier in injectable delivery systems for hydrophobic drugs.

Bronchiolitis obliterans organizing pneumonia as an initial manifestation in patients with systemic lupus erythematosus. J Rheumatol 1997; 24:2254-7. [PMID: 9375894]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/05/2023]
Abstract
Diverse pleuropulmonary manifestations including diaphragmatic dysfunction, pleural effusion, acute lupus pneumonitis, pulmonary hemorrhage, pulmonary hypertension, and diffuse interstitial lung disease have been described in patients with systemic lupus erythematosus (SLE). Bronchiolitis obliterans organizing pneumonia (BOOP) as an initial manifestation of SLE is rarely reported. We describe 2 patients who had SLE concurrent with the onset of BOOP. Their respiratory symptoms, followup pulmonary function tests, and radiologic findings showed much improvement after steroid therapy.

Genotyping by PCR-ELISA of a complex polymorphic region that contains one to four copies of six highly homologous human VH3 genes. PROCEEDINGS OF THE ASSOCIATION OF AMERICAN PHYSICIANS 1997; 109:558-64. [PMID: 9394417]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Subscribe] [Scholar Register] [Indexed: 02/05/2023]
Abstract
The Humhv3005 human VH gene is located in an intricate locus that encompasses for each haplotype a combination of one to four copies of six highly homologous VH3 genes. To assess the complexity of this region, we developed a polymerase chain reaction-enzyme-derived immunosorbent assay (PCR-ELISA) method capable of detecting each of the VH3 genes. The method consisted of amplification of selected germline VH3 genes with a biotinylated primer, covalent capture of the amplicons onto streptavidin-coated wells, and quantitative typing of the bound VH3 genes with diagnostic oligonucleotides. Pilot studies of two DNA samples with known presence or absence of hv3005 [according to a characteristic BamH1 restriction fragment-length polymorphism (RFLP)] yielded the expected results. Subsequent analysis of 100 additional DNA samples with the known EcoR1 RFLP of hv3005 showed a complete match between the absence of the 9.4-kb hybridizing band and lack of hv3005-like genes, as determined by PCR-ELISA. Importantly, the PCR-ELISA analyses of these 102 genomic DNA samples revealed two new haplotypes in the complex hv3005 region. Combined, these data demonstrate the usefulness and efficiency of this new technique to ascertain the presence or absence of six highly homologous genes in an unusually heterogeneous duplication-insertion-deletion region. In the future, a similar strategy may be used to dissect other similarly complex VH genetic loci.

Abstract
The comb-type polycation consisting of a poly[2-(diethylamino)ethyl methacrylate] (PDEAEMA) backbone and poly(L-lysine) (PLL) side chains has been prepared as a novel pH-sensitive DNA carrier. The comb-type copolymer PDEAEMA-graft-PLL was prepared by using the macromonomer method, in which a poly(N epsilon-carbobenzoxy-L-lysine) macromonomer was radically copolymerized with DEAEMA. The comb-type copolymer exhibited a two-step proton dissociation and a dual ionic character owing to the two cationic segments in the copolymer, as determined by acid-base titration. In addition, the comb-type copolymer caused no significant turbidity even at pH 10, whereas PDEAEMA homopolymer suddenly precipitated out of the aqueous medium above pH 7.5 owing to the deprotonation of amino groups. Furthermore, a 1H NMR study proved that protonated PLL segments solubilized the comb-type copolymer with a hydrophobic PDEAEMA core at higher pH. Finally, the pH-dependent behavior of the DNA complex with the comb-type copolymer was evaluated. The discontinuous turbidity change of the DNA/PDEAEMA-graft-PLL mixture at pH 7.5 suggested that the solubility of the complex varied in response to pH. By circular dichroism measurement, we also found that the comb-type copolymer was capable of varying DNA compaction pH-dependently. In conclusion, we have demonstrated that the comb-type copolymer is capable of sensing a pH signal and outputting the nonlinear change of the physicochemical properties of DNA polyelectrolyte complexes.

Decreased tumour necrosis factor-beta production in TNFB*2 homozygote: an important predisposing factor of lupus nephritis in Koreans. Lupus 1997; 6:603-9. [PMID: 9302664 DOI: 10.1177/096120339700600708] [Citation(s) in RCA: 21]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/05/2023]
Abstract
Low TNF production and its association with TNF gene restriction fragment length polymorphism (RFLP) was demonstrated in (NZW/NZB) F1 mice. However, little is known about the significance of TNF production in association with TNF gene polymorphism in human SLE. This study was designed to evaluate the role of TNF production of peripheral blood mononuclear cells (PBMC) and its association with TNFB gene polymorphism in SLE, particularly lupus nephritis. TNFB gene polymorphism was defined by PCR-NcoI RFLP. TNF productions of phytohemagglutinin (PHA)-stimulated PBMC and T cells were examined by bioassay using L929 cell line and ELISA. The PBMC stimulated by PHA from patients with SLE (n = 60) tended to secrete less amounts of TNF by bioassay (1032 +/- 184 pg/ml vs 1524 +/- 224 pg/ml, P = 0.094), and TNF-beta by ELISA (P = 0.0082) than that from normal controls (n = 38). The low TNF-alpha producer was more frequent in nephritis than non-nephritis (34.4% vs 7.1% respectively, P < 0.01). TNF-beta also revealed similar results (53.1% vs 21.4%, P < 0.05). In SLE, mean production of TNF-beta was decreased in TNFB*2 homozygote (n = 18) than that in TNFB*1 homozygote (n = 9) (1126.3 +/- 145 pg/ml) vs 642 +/- 118.4 pg/ml, respectively, P = 0.021), whereas TNF-alpha production showed little difference between the two groups (710.1 +/- 56.4 vs 542.4 +/- 71.1 pg/ml, respectively, P = 0.149). Our results demonstrate that decreased TNF production of PBMC, which was significantly associated with TNFB*2 homozygosity, could be an important predisposing factor of lupus nephritis in Koreans.

Abstract
OBJECTIVE To evaluate the patterns of Ro autoantigen recognition in Korean patients with primary Sjögren's syndrome (SS) and to investigate its clinical significance in SS. METHODS Sera from primary SS (n = 51) and systemic lupus erythematosus (SLE) (n = 132) were tested by double immunodiffusion test and immunoblotting for reactivity with 60 kDa and 52 kDa Ro/SS-A proteins. Clinical manifestations were evaluated on the basis of the presence of anti-Ro/SS-A antibodies and anti-60 kDa/52 kDa proteins. RESULTS The prevalence of anti-Ro/SS-A antibodies in Korean patients with primary SS was 64.7%. In immunoblotting analysis, the incidence of anti-60 kDa without anti-52 kDa was lower in patients with SS(3.0% vs. 11.6%, p > 0.05), whereas anti-52 kDa without anti-60 kDa was more common in SS patients than in SLE patients(42.5% vs. 4.3%, p < 0.001). Patients with anti-Ro/SS-A antibody were significantly associated with the presence of vasculitis, hyperglobulinemia and rheumatoid factor in primary SS (p < 0.05). CONCLUSION The patterns of 52 kDa and 60 kDa Ro autoantigen recognition were quite different in the SLE and primary SS. Anti-52 kDa without anti-60 kDa antibody may be used as a diagnostic marker for primary SS. Although the presence of anti-Ro/SS-A antibody was closely associated with certain clinical features in SS, these clinical manifestations were not correlated with the presence of antibodies against each 52 kDa and 60 kDa proteins. Extended studies with a large population are required to determine the clinical correlation of autoantibodies against each peptides or epitopes of Ro/SS-A proteins.

The impact of HLA-DRB1*0405 on disease severity in Korean patients with seropositive rheumatoid arthritis. BRITISH JOURNAL OF RHEUMATOLOGY 1997; 36:440-3. [PMID: 9159536 DOI: 10.1093/rheumatology/36.4.440] [Citation(s) in RCA: 22]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
Many reports have described HLA-DRB1 genes as having an influence on disease severity and susceptibility in rheumatoid arthritis (RA). Studies were undertaken to define the effect of RA-associated alleles on disease severity in Korean patients with seropositive RA. The results indicate that the most common RA susceptibility allele, HLA-DRB1*0405, is significantly associated with bony erosion, joint deformity and extra-articular manifestations. However, RA-associated alleles in Koreans have less effect on nodular disease than in Caucasians. This suggests that the presence of RA-associated alleles, especially HLA-DRB1*0405, seems to be a prognostic marker for severe erosive disease in Koreans.

Abstract
Although serum transfer studies implicate IgG anti-platelet autoantibodies in the premature platelet destruction of idiopathic thrombocytopenic purpura (ITP), many characteristics of these putative pathogenic autoantibodies remain unclear. The inability to obtain relevant monoclonal autoantibodies from patients has prevented their molecular, genetic and functional studies as a homogenous population. We have generated a monoclonal IgG anti-platelet alpha IIb beta 3 autoantibody (termed G1) from an ITP patient. G1 binds human platelets (both resting and activated) and purified alpha IIb beta 3 with a Kd of 1.57 x 10(-8) M. G1 utilizes VH4 and V lambda 2 genes. The G1 VH region apparently has a 30 nucleotide insertion in its second complementarity determining region (CDR). Notably, somatic CDR insertion in the VH region has been observed only in one IgG rheumatoid factor, and not in any characterized polyreactive human autoantibodies reported in the literature. Combined these data suggest G1 may be a disease-relevant autoantibody. Further generation and study of monoclonal IgG anti-platelet antibodies are warranted to determine the significance of such unusual autoantibodies in the immunopathogenesis of chronic ITP.

Difference in adhesion and proliferation of fibroblast between Langmuir-Blodgett films and cast surfaces of poly (gamma-benzyL L-glutamate)/poly(ethylene oxide) diblock copolymer. JOURNAL OF BIOMEDICAL MATERIALS RESEARCH 1996; 32:425-32. [PMID: 8897148 DOI: 10.1002/(sici)1097-4636(199611)32:3<425::aid-jbm16>3.0.co;2-f] [Citation(s) in RCA: 14]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/02/2023]
Abstract
Block copolymers consisting of poly (gamma-benzyl L-glutamate) and poly (ethylene oxide) as the hydrophobic and hydrophilic components, respectively were prepared. Cell attachment onto the surfaces of block copolymers fabricated either as well-defined ordered Langmuir-Blodgett (LB) films or solvent cast microphase-separated structures was studied. On ordered LB surfaces, adherent fibroblasts were larger than on the microphase-separated cast surfaces within 15 min. The difference in cell adhesion between LB films and cast surfaces increased with increasing PEO contents in block copolymer. Adherent cells increased with an increase in surface pressure of LB films in any polymer. Phase-contrast microphotographs of adherent cells showed rapid and extensive morphologic changes associated with the LB surface as compared to cast film surfaces. The number of cells grown on the LB surface is greater than that on the cast film.

Systemic lupus erythematosus with nephritis is strongly associated with the TNFB*2 homozygote in the Korean population. Hum Immunol 1996; 46:10-7. [PMID: 9157084 DOI: 10.1016/0198-8859(95)00170-0] [Citation(s) in RCA: 36]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
To evaluate the association of TNFB NcoI polymorphism with SLE in the Korean population, we investigated the frequencies of the TNFB and HLADRB1 alleles in 281 controls and 97 SLE patients, including 56 patients with nephritis and 41 patients without nephritis. The frequency of the TNFB*2 homozygote in SLE was significantly increased over controls (43.3% vs 28.5%, RR = 1.9,p < 0.01). In SLE with nephritis, the TNFB*2 homozygote was more significantly increased (57.1% vs 28.5%, RR = 3.4,p < 0.0001), whereas there was no significant difference between SLE without nephritis and controls. The study of HLA-DRB 1 alleles revealed the increased frequencies of DRB1*02 and *03 (30.9% vs 18.2%, RR = 2.0,p < 0.01; 8.2% vs 2.1%, RR = 4.1,p < 0.05). There was no significantly different distribution of HLA-DRB1 alleles between SLE patients with nephritis and without nephritis. We found positive LD between TNFB*1 and HLA-DR1B1*13, and between TNFB*2 and the particular DRB1 allele: *15, *04, and *07 in controls and/or in SLE patients. After stratification for each HLADRB1 allele, SLE with nephritis showed a higher frequency of TNFB*2 homozygote compared with the corresponding controls in DRB1*15, *08, and *09 positives. Our results suggest that the TNFB*2 homozygote may be a strong susceptibility gene of SLE with nephritis in the Korean population.

Protein losing enteropathy associated with Henoch-Schönlein purpura in a patient with rheumatoid arthritis. Scand J Rheumatol 1996; 25:334-6. [PMID: 8921929 DOI: 10.3109/03009749609104068] [Citation(s) in RCA: 9]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
Protein losing enteropathy is rarely associated with Henoch-Schönlein purpura. Moreover, the disease association of Henoch-Schönlein purpura and rheumatoid arthritis is also rare. We report a case of a 46 year old patient with rheumatoid arthritis presenting with Henoch-Schönlein purpura associated with protein losing enteropathy.

Effect of ligand orientation on hepatocyte attachment onto the poly(N-p-vinylbenzyl-o-beta-D-galactopyranosyl-D-gluconamide) as a model ligand of asialoglycoprotein. JOURNAL OF BIOMATERIALS SCIENCE. POLYMER EDITION 1996; 7:1097-104. [PMID: 8880441 DOI: 10.1163/156856296x00589] [Citation(s) in RCA: 20]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/02/2023]
Abstract
The orientation effect of galactose ligand on hepatocyte attachment was investigated. Poly(N-p-vinylbenzyl-o-beta-D-galactopyranosyl-D-gluconamide )(PVLA), a beta-galactose-carrying styrene homopolymer, was used as a model ligand for the asialoglycoprotein receptors on hepatocytes. PVLA was transferred onto the poly(gamma-benzyl L-glutamate) (PBLG) or PBLG/poly(ethylene glycol) (PEG)PBLG Langmuir-Blodgett (LB) films as the monolayer level. The dichroic fluorescence values of the confocal microscope indicated that the PVLA transferred onto the LB films was located with a preferential orientation of its molecular axes with regard to the direction of the alpha-helix of polypeptide. Hepatocyte recognized well-oriented galactose moieties of the surface of PVLA through asialoglycoprotein receptors.

Abstract
Antiphospholipid syndrome is characterized by recurrent episodes of arterial and venous thrombosis, spontaneous fetal losses, thrombocytopenia and persistently elevated levels of antiphospholipid antibodies. We experienced a case of Budd-Chiari syndrome in a 32-year old female lupus patient who was presented with left leg edema, ascites and esophageal varix. The clinical and laboratory findings were compatible with the cirteria for systemic lupus erythematosus (SLE) and she was found to have anticardiolipin antibody, thrombocytopenia and prolonged partial thromboplastin time. Initially, she was treated with intravenous heparin and uroki nase and she was followed up with warfarin, baby aspirin and steroids.

Abstract
OBJECTIVE To identify the association of HLA-DR4 subtypes with rheumatoid arthritis (RA) in Koreans. METHODS Ninety five patients with RA and 118 normal control subjects were examined for HLA-DR antigens by serology. Subtypes of HLA-DR4 were determined by allele specific oligonucleotide typing. RESULTS The phenotype frequency of HLA-DR4 in RA patients was significantly greater than that in controls (60.0% versus 31.4%, odds ratio (OR) 3.28, 95% confidence interval (CI) 1.79 to 6.02 (p < 0.001)), but HLA-DR6 was decreased in RA patients (15.8% versus 32.2%, OR 0.39, 95% CI 0.19 to 0.81 (p < 0.001)). When DR4 was excluded from analysis of patients and controls, the allele frequency of DR1 was significantly increased in the patients compared with controls (11.3% versus 4.5%, OR 2.73, 95% CI 0.87 to 5.95 (p < 0.001)). Forty two of 57 DR4 positive patients (73.7%) possessed DRB1*0405, which was strongly associated with RA (44.2% of patients, versus 11.9% of controls: OR 5.88, 95% CI 2.81 to 12.47 (p < 0.001)). DRB1*0403 was not found in the patients, but was present in 8.5% of controls. Examining the third hyper-variable region at position 70-74 in the DRB1*04 chain by oligotyping, we found that 52 of 57 DR4 positive patients (91.2%) carried one of the conserved amino acid sequences QRRAA or QKRAA, known to be the epitope conferring predisposition to RA. CONCLUSION This study confirms that RA is strongly associated with DR4, especially with DRB1*0405, and that the presence of the inferred QRRAA sequence may be important in susceptibility to RA in Koreans.

Abstract
OBJECTIVES To elucidate the gene frequency of TNFB Ncol polymorphism and its association with HLA class II antigen in patients with systemic lupus erythematosus(SLE) in Korea. METHODS We investigated the gene frequency of the TNFB alleles using DNA obtained from peripheral mononuclar cells in 141 healthy controls and in 58 patients with SLE. The polymorphisms of TNFB gene (735 bp) were studied by Ncol PCR-RELP. A portion of TNFB gene(735 bp) was amplified by PCR and its products were digested with Ncol restriction enzyme. The digested samples of amplified DNA were analyzed by agarose gel electrophoresis. TNFB*1 and TNFB*2 alleles were identified according to polymorphic fragments on Ncol restriction site in the first intron of the TNFB gene. The generic types of HLA-DRBI were also determined by PCR with sequence specific primers(SSP) using genomic DNA from the same subjects. RESULTS The genotypic frequency of TNFB*2 homozygote was significantly increased in patients with SLE compared with controls(RR = 2.36, P = 0.011). The frequency of HLA-DRBI*15 was also significantly increased in patients (RR = 2.27, P = 0.029). However, the increased frequency of TNFB*2 homozygote was apparently increased in nephritis group (RR = 2.79, P = 0.035), whereas the significance of TNFB*2 homozygote was weakend in non-nephritis group. CONCLUSIONS Our results suggest that genetic predisposition of TNFB*2 homozygote is another risk factor in Korean SLE, especially in DR2 negative patients. In addition, TNFB*2 homozygote could have a tendency for the development of nephritis in patients with SLE.

Abstract
Although autoimmune thyroid diseases have been associated with systemic lupus erythematosus (SLE), the prevalence of thyroid disorder is controversial. To clarify the prevalence of thyroid disorder in Korean patients with SLE, thyroid functions and diseases were evaluated in 63 SLE patients. Of these patients, Hashimoto's thyroiditis (9.5%) as well as euthyroid sick syndrome (14.3%) were more common than Graves' disease (4.8%). The prevalence of antithyroid autoantibodies (antimicrosomal and/or antithyroglobulin autoantibodies) in SLE was 27.0%. High titers of these autoantibodies were mainly detected in Hashimoto's thyroiditis. These results suggested that thyroid diseases are not uncommon in SLE and autoimmune thyroid diseases are possible manifestations in some patients with SLE. Antithyroid autoantibodies may be good predictors for the detection of Hashimoto's thyroiditis developing in SLE.

Immunopharmacological studies of low molecular weight polysaccharide from Angelica sinensis. THE AMERICAN JOURNAL OF CHINESE MEDICINE 1994; 22:137-45. [PMID: 7992813 DOI: 10.1142/s0192415x94000176] [Citation(s) in RCA: 25]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
A low molecular weight polysaccharide has been isolated from the rhizome of Angelica sinensis (Oliv.) Diels (Umbelliferaer). It has a molecular weight of approximately 3,000 and consists of protein (4.73%) and carbohydrate (85.85%) of which 5.2% is uronic acid. It shows strong anti-tumor activity on Ehrlich Ascites tumor bearing mice. It also exhibits immunostimulating activities, both in vitro and in vivo.

Cell adhesion onto block copolymer Langmuir-Blodgett films. JOURNAL OF BIOMEDICAL MATERIALS RESEARCH 1993; 27:199-206. [PMID: 8436576 DOI: 10.1002/jbm.820270209] [Citation(s) in RCA: 11]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/30/2023]
Abstract
The attachment of cells onto the surfaces of various block copolymers fabricated either as well-defined, ordered Langmuir-Blodgett (LB) films, or solvent cast microphase-separated structures was studied. In general, more platelets adhered onto the multilayered LB surface than onto microphase-separated cast surfaces. Scanning electron micrographs of adhered platelets showed extensive morphological changes associated with the LB surface as compared to cast film surfaces. The morphology of adhered hepatocytes was similar for both LB films and cast surfaces. It may be assumed that the surface of a block copolymer LB film does not orient into microdomains, as in the solvent cast surfaces, and only one polymer domain interacts at the interface.

Abstract
The narcotic antagonist naltrexone (I) was modified at the 3 and 14 hydroxyl positions and covalently coupled to a biodegradable poly(alpha-amino acid) backbone through a labile bond. Selective acetylation of I with acetic anhydride gave naltrexone-3-acetate (II), which was subsequently succinoylated to naltrexone-3-acetate-14-hemisuccinate (III) with succinic anhydride. The polymeric backbone chosen for initial coupling experiments was poly-N5-(3-hydroxypropyl)-L-glutamine (PHPG). The side-chain hydroxyl functionality permitted covalent bonding of III through an ester linkage. Hydrolysis of covalently bound drug to give naltrexone or its derivatives (II and III) should be much slower than diffusion of drug through the polymer matrix. While hydrolysis of naltrexone from the polymer side chain is first order, release of drug from the matrix can be zero order due to the geometry of the device and the physical and chemical interactions between naltrexone and the polymer matrix. In vitro studies of PHPG-naltrexone conjugate in disk form did not show constant release because of the hydrophilic nature of the polymer backbone and the changing local chemical environment upon hydrolysis of drug-polymer linkages. The conjugated system was made more hydrophobic by coupling drug to copolymers of hydroxypropyl-L-glutamine (HPG) and L-leucine. Conjugates of III coupled with copoly(HPG-70/Leu-30) demonstrated a nearly constant, but slightly declining release rate of naltrexone and its derivatives for 28 days in vitro.

Abstract
Three cases of Charcot spinal arthropathy in long-standing (greater than 20 years) paraplegia are presented. In this group of patients with other known chronic infections, the differential diagnosis strongly favored osteomyelitis. Scanning techniques including technetium 99, indium 111, and computed tomography (CT) were used in the extensive work-up and were helpful, although not diagnostic. Closed needle and, in two cases, open biopsies eventually confirmed the diagnosis. The possible occurrence of this neuroarthropathy long after the onset of nonprogressive paraplegia should be kept in mind by those treating spinal cord injured patients.
